Objective Comparison of the VENDLET and Manual Transfer

Objective Comparison of manual and mechanic transfers A study, conducted by Professor Dr. Hans Günter Lindner from TH Köln University of Applied Sciences, shows, that using Vendlet in the transfer of bedridden clients result in great benefits in work health & safety, client comfort and overall efficiency, when compared to manual transfer methods.

Vendlet V5S - HLS Healthcare Pty Ltd

Vendlet V5S. The Vendlet V5S is a patient transfer aid for turning and repositioning patients in bed. The assistive device makes it possible to perform a gentle and smooth repositioning of the patient, which requires a minimum of strain and effort of healthcare staff. Safe Working Load: 200 kg.

  • How did the vendlet turn system come about?

    Because the turning motion is fully mechanised, it takes just one carer to reposition a client in bed, with zero manual handling. The original Vendlet system was developed by a Danish innovator who had noticed that his wife was struggling with the physical strain of turning their disabled daughter in bed.
